I am doing pretty well at tightening the groups on my Tikka T3.
I did notice yesterday at Hilltop a small problem that needs solving. I was shooting at 100 meters, so I preset the side mount parallax (Athlon ARES 6-24 x 50 BTR mil) to about 110 yards. 109 yards= 100 meters. The target was in focus and the reticle was no giving me an eyestrain headache so no problems there. However, bobbing my head over the stock showed that parallax was not aligned. I adjusted the parallax until the reticle and target were rock solid. The target was then out of focus. I was closer to 140yards on the parallax dial.
Is this a problem with the scope, my 49 year old eyes, my contacts, or something else altogether? I am near sighted requiring glasses or contacts to see far, and in the past 4 years, if I am wearing contacts, I need reading glasses to see close. Sigh……
